In Ohio speech, Joe Biden confuses the name of the college he's visiting
September 12, 2012 | Modified: September 12, 2012 at 12:39 pm Leave a comment
Speaking to an audience at Wright State University this morning in Dayton Ohio, Vice President Joe Biden mistakenly called the university "Wayne State."
The audience quickly caught the error and corrected him.
